The Capitol region's mix of government contractors, automotive suppliers, and professional-services firms creates predictable but slow-paying receivables. State agencies and university departments follow reimbursement schedules that ignore your cash-flow calendar. Factoring accounts receivable financing turns that timing mismatch into a competitive advantage. You can bid on larger contracts, extend payment terms to win clients, and grow without the cash reserves that would otherwise sit idle. For businesses operating near the I-96 and US-127 interchange serving clients across Greater Lansing, this flexibility accelerates growth that waiting 60 days per invoice would stall.
